Deep Chocolate Cream Pie

Chocolate cream pie needs a custard dark enough to stand up to whipped cream. Cocoa gives depth and chopped chocolate gives a clean set without gelatin. Keep whisking once it boils; starch thickens only after that first real bubble.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 8

Ingredients
  

  • 1 fully baked 9-inch All-Purpose Flaky Pie Crust cooled
  • 3 cups whole milk
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/3 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1/4 cup cornstarch
  • 1/4 tsp kosher salt
  • 4 large egg yolks
  • 4 oz semisweet chocolate chopped
  • 2 tbsp unsalted butter
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 1/2 cups heavy cream
  • 2 tbsp powdered sugar

Method
 

  1. Whisk the milk, granulated sugar, cocoa, cornstarch, salt and egg yolks in a heavy saucepan until smooth.
  2. Cook over medium heat, whisking constantly, until the custard boils, then continue for 1 minute.
  3. Remove from the heat, stir in the chocolate, butter and vanilla until smooth, and pour into the cooled crust.
  4. Press parchment directly on the filling and refrigerate for at least 5 hours.
  5. Beat the cream and powdered sugar to soft peaks, spoon it over the chilled pie in a simple uneven layer, and slice with a hot dry knife.
